Abstract
Testing Leadership for Project and Programme Managers is a practitioner playbook for project and programme leaders who commission, resource, govern and make decisions using software-testing and assurance evidence. Its governing proposition is that testing may be performed by specialists, but the conditions in which testing succeeds are created by project leadership. The playbook therefore treats testing not merely as a delivery phase or defect-finding activity, but as a lifecycle source of decision evidence. Across twenty chapters, the book addresses the decisions that shape testing from project initiation through live operation: understanding testing needs; defining proportionate scope and assurance; appointing capability; estimating and funding testing; providing environments, data, tools and access; securing business participation; governing strategy, readiness, defects and suppliers; evaluating evidence; making release decisions; validating live service; learning from incidents; and sustaining quality beyond project closure. The publication introduces an integrated CEREARK management architecture built around Shift Left, Lead Through, Stay Right and Build Trust. It includes the Five Testing Duties — Understand, Provide, Enable, Challenge and Decide — together with connected decision models, evidence questions and 79 ready-to-use field tools. A fictional Meridian Citizen Services Programme provides a cumulative case through which the management consequences of testing decisions are illustrated across the delivery lifecycle. The publication synthesises established software-testing, project-delivery and assurance practice and draws on the standards and authoritative sources identified in its reference foundations.
